Egypt competed at the 2004 Summer Paralympics in Athens, Greece. The team included 46 athletes, 36 men and 10 women. The Egyptian team included 46 sportspeople, 10 women and 36 men. This was 2 fewer women than the country had sent to Sydney for the 2000 Games.[1][2] Three members of the delegation, including two athletes, participated in a study about dental health during the Games.[3]
The men's team won a bronze medal after defeating Germany in the bronze medal game.
Egyptian broadcasting rights for the 2004 Games were acquired before the start of the Games.[4]
